§ 03

Application process

Application → plan check → issuance → inspection → final

  1. 01
    Confirm the project scope with Cumberland County Planning and Inspections because Falcon does not publish a separate town permit handbook.
  2. 02
    Review the applicable county checklist from the All Other Permits page for the project type.
  3. 03
    Register in county EnerGov and submit the permit package with all supporting plans, contractor information, and owner affidavit or lien materials where required.
  4. 04
    Pay county fees and respond to review comments through the county process.
  5. 05
    Request inspections through Cumberland County after permit issuance.
  6. 06
    Coordinate any purely municipal questions through Falcon Town Hall, but use the county for actual permit intake and code review.

§ 04

Fee schedule

Falcon building permit fees

Fee type
Amount
01
Minimum permit fee
$50 zoning permit; $100 many residential trade and miscellaneous permits
02
Plan check fee
Included in county planning and inspections fee schedule.
03
Permit fee formula
Mixed county fee schedule with square-foot, valuation-tier, flat, and per-unit calculations.
04
Reinspection fee
Residential reinspection $75; work without permit double permit fee; contractor change $25 per trade

County accepts in-person, phone, and mailed check payments, plus major cards.
